Benefits of Asian Dried Squid Snack for Health-Conscious Consumers

Why Choose Asian Dried Squid Snack for Your Business Needs?

Asian dried squid snacks are gaining popularity, especially among health-conscious consumers. These snacks are low in calories and high in protein. They provide a satisfying alternative to traditional chips or sweets. The firm, chewy texture is both interesting and filling.

Incorporating dried squid into a diet can offer various health advantages. It is rich in omega-3 fatty acids, which support heart health. Many consumers appreciate the low-fat content, making it an appealing choice. The unique flavor profile also makes it versatile for pairing with various cuisines. Dried squid can be enjoyed as a standalone snack or added to salads and rice dishes.

However, not all squid snacks are created equal. Some may contain excessive sodium or artificial preservatives. Consumers should carefully read labels to ensure healthier options. The balance between taste and nutrition is essential. Potentially, these snacks can be overconsumed, leading to unintended health implications. Making informed decisions can enhance the benefits of dried squid in a balanced diet.

Nutritional Profile of Asian Dried Squid: Protein and Mineral Content

Asian dried squid snacks are gaining popularity for their nutritional benefits. This seafood snack is rich in protein, offering about 30 grams per 100 grams serving, according to nutrition reports. Protein is essential for muscle growth and repair. It plays a crucial role in maintaining overall health. For businesses, this high protein content attracts health-conscious consumers.

In addition to protein, dried squid is also a significant source of minerals. It contains high levels of iron, zinc, and magnesium. For example, a serving can provide over 100% of the daily value for iron. This is particularly beneficial for individuals in need of iron-rich foods. Such mineral content supports immune function and promotes healthy metabolism.
